Many industries are being ushered into a more sustainable future whether they like it or not, due to regulatory mandates. But the reality is, we live in an era of fast fashion, where despite the best efforts of sustainability campaigners, people buy more clothes than they wear, resulting in them being burnt or ending up in landfills.  Less than 1 per cent of used textiles worldwide are recycled into new textile fibres. But now, a novel technology is changing things for the better. German startup eeden has developed a chemical process that recovers cellulose from cotton and transforms polyester into its basic building blocks. Both raw materials can then be processed into new, high-quality textile fibres and given a second life, creating a sustainable and economically beneficial closed loop.
